Frameshifting deletions in Orf7b seem being back recently,
Here we document a NL.6 sublineage rising in. prevalence in Denmark after getting the new orf7b
Interesting this time is a little bit different than in the XBB era, because here we have two nucleotides removed (del27795 and del27796) and it starts from Orf7b:F13- that is replaced by TTT so it maintains F as first AA of the frameshifted ORF7b after Orf7b:F13- for this reason Gisaid sees it del27795-96 and not del27792-93 as nextclade does)

The new orf7b resulting from the frameshift is:
Orf7b:1MIELSLIDFYLCFSLSATPCFNYAYYLLVLT32stop
instead of
Orf7b:1MIELSLIDFYLCFLAFLLLLVLIMLIIFWFSLELQDHNETCHA44stop

@corneliusroemer please consider that:

  1. this represents most of NL.6: 106/136
  2. most of the samples of this has also ORF1a:L3754F(G11527T), T19725G : 93/106
  3. It has been sampled in 5 different countries and in the US in 5 different states, so clearly real

NL.6>> Orf7b:F14-(del27795_27796) > ORF1a:L3754F(G11527T), T19725G
Query:C18526T, G25088T, del27795_27796
Samples: 106
First sampled on 2024-09-30 in Den
Places: Denmark 74, US 24(MN 17,IA,MI 2,RI,OH 3),Netherlands 4, Ireland 2, England 2
